The University of Southampton Students' Union, provides support, representation and social activities for the students ranging from involvement in the Union's four media outlets, to any of the 200 affiliated societies and 80 sports. [9]
With the aim that 'every student loves their time at Southampton', the new strategy sets out the Union's purpose to 'help students form friendship groups, support students to complete their degree programmes and give students a voice in the university and wider community.' Highfield Campus is the main campus of the University of Southampton and is located in Southampton, southern England. It is the largest of the university's campuses with most of the students studying there. The campus is also the location of the main university library, the students' union as well as sports facilities.

Oxford University Student Union was reported as having voted to disaffiliate in 2014, [6] but this was overturned after voting irregularities were uncovered. [7] Four unions voted to leave the national body in 2016 Lincoln, Newcastle, Hull and Loughborough (Lincoln later rejoined but has since again disaffiliated).
